BANDUNG, W Java, June 3 Asia Pulse - The rupiah's exchange rate against the US dollar is likely to remain relatively stable over the next couple of months, Bank Indonesia governor Syahril Sabirin said over the weekend.
Syahril said the prediction was based on various factors, including the decreasing need for US dollars to cover foreign debts and import financing.
He made the prediction in his general lecture to post-graduate students of the Padjadjaran University.
He said the good dollar supply would be supported by the disbursement of funds from the International Monetary Fund, the divestment of bank shares and the privatization of state enterprises.
"Besides, the export performance is expected to improve in line with the hike in international oil price and the improved economic condition in the United States," he said.
Seen from the point of view of market sentiments, he explained, the strengthening of the rupiah's exchange rate would be enhanced by the government's success in negotiating the rescheduling of government debts to commercial banks/creditors in the next London Club forum.
